org.embl.ebi.escience.scuflworkers
Class ProcessorInfoBeanHelper

java.lang.Object
  extended by org.embl.ebi.escience.scuflworkers.ProcessorInfoBeanHelper
All Implemented Interfaces:
ProcessorInfoBean
Direct Known Subclasses:
APIConsumerProcessorInfoBean, APProcessorInfoBean, BeanshellProcessorInfoBean, BiomartProcessorInfoBean, BiomobyObjectProcessorInfoBean, BiomobyProcessorInfoBean, BSFProcessorInfoBean, InfernoProcessorInfoBean, LocalServiceProcessorInfoBean, MobyParseDatatypeProcessorInfoBean, NotificationProcessorInfoBean, RDFGeneratorProcessorInfoBean, RservProcessorInfoBean, RshellProcessorInfoBean, SoaplabProcessorInfoBean, StringConstantProcessorInfoBean, TalismanProcessorInfoBean, WorkflowProcessorInfoBean, WSDLProcessorInfoBean

public class ProcessorInfoBeanHelper
extends java.lang.Object
implements ProcessorInfoBean

Generic helper class to aid in retreiving processor information from taverna.properties

Author:
Stuart Owen

Constructor Summary
ProcessorInfoBeanHelper(java.lang.String tagname)
           
 
Method Summary
 java.lang.String colour()
           
 java.lang.String editorClassname()
           
 javax.swing.ImageIcon icon()
           
 java.lang.String processorClassname()
           
 java.lang.String scavengerClassname()
           
 java.lang.String tag()
           
 java.lang.String taskClassname()
           
 java.lang.String xmlHandlerClassname()
           
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

ProcessorInfoBeanHelper

public ProcessorInfoBeanHelper(java.lang.String tagname)
Method Detail

processorClassname

public java.lang.String processorClassname()
Specified by:
processorClassname in interface ProcessorInfoBean

xmlHandlerClassname

public java.lang.String xmlHandlerClassname()
Specified by:
xmlHandlerClassname in interface ProcessorInfoBean

colour

public java.lang.String colour()
Specified by:
colour in interface ProcessorInfoBean

icon

public javax.swing.ImageIcon icon()
Specified by:
icon in interface ProcessorInfoBean

taskClassname

public java.lang.String taskClassname()
Specified by:
taskClassname in interface ProcessorInfoBean

editorClassname

public java.lang.String editorClassname()
Specified by:
editorClassname in interface ProcessorInfoBean

scavengerClassname

public java.lang.String scavengerClassname()
Specified by:
scavengerClassname in interface ProcessorInfoBean

tag

public java.lang.String tag()
Specified by:
tag in interface ProcessorInfoBean